Vitamin B12 and Energy Metabolism
Perhaps the most potent energy-related nutrient in oysters is vitamin B12. A deficiency in this vitamin can lead to profound fatigue and weakness. A typical serving of oysters provides well over the daily recommended intake of B12. This vitamin is essential for several bodily functions, including nerve health, brain function, and the formation of red blood cells. Red blood cells are responsible for carrying oxygen throughout the body, and their healthy production is critical for sustained energy.
Iron and Oxygen Transport
Another critical nutrient found abundantly in oysters is iron. Iron is a fundamental component of hemoglobin, the protein in red blood cells that transports oxygen from the lungs to all other tissues in the body. Low iron levels lead to anemia, a condition characterized by significant fatigue, shortness of breath, and weakness. The rich iron content in oysters helps ensure efficient oxygen transport, directly supporting energy levels.
Zinc's Role in Cellular Function
While not a direct energy source, zinc is a cofactor for hundreds of enzymes involved in various bodily processes, including metabolism. Oysters are one of the richest dietary sources of zinc. A well-functioning metabolism is key to converting nutrients into energy efficiently. Zinc also plays a crucial role in immune system function, which helps the body conserve energy for other uses.
The Raw vs. Cooked Oyster Nutritional Profile
Cooking oysters can alter their nutritional content. While many nutrients remain stable, high-heat cooking can reduce certain vitamin levels. However, the primary energy-boosting nutrients—vitamin B12, iron, and zinc—are generally well-retained, but safety concerns often take precedence for raw consumption.
| Nutrient | Raw Oysters (approx. 3oz) | Cooked Oysters (approx. 3oz) | Impact on Energy |
|---|---|---|---|
| Vitamin B12 | >100% of RDI | Retained in most cooking | Supports cellular energy and red blood cell production |
| Iron | Significant source (24% RDI) | Retained | Aids in oxygen transport to all tissues |
| Zinc | >400% of RDI | Retained | Supports metabolism and immune function |
| Protein | Good source (7-8g) | Retained | Builds muscle and provides sustained energy |
| Omega-3s | Present | Retained in most cooking | Supports brain function and reduces inflammation |
Safety Considerations for Raw Oysters
While the nutritional benefits are clear, it is crucial to address the risks associated with eating raw oysters. Raw shellfish can carry harmful bacteria like Vibrio vulnificus. Though rare, infection can be severe or fatal, especially for vulnerable individuals. Cooking oysters properly is the only way to eliminate this risk. The CDC provides guidelines for safe cooking to ensure the destruction of any potential pathogens.
- Who should avoid raw oysters? Individuals with liver disease, diabetes, weakened immune systems, pregnant women, and young children are at a much higher risk of serious illness from consuming raw oysters.
- How to minimize risk: If you choose to eat raw oysters, purchase them from reputable suppliers who can provide information on their harvest location and handling.
- The danger of appearance: An oyster containing harmful bacteria will not look, smell, or taste different from any other oyster. This is why cooking is the only reliable method for safety.
